Stop Courts from granting care orders based on suspected risk of future harm.

Rejected 12 signatures

What the petition asks

We believe current laws on removing children from parents are outdated and unjust. Currently a court can grant a care order removing children from their parents if they are 'likely to suffer harm'. This can mean children can be removed even if they have come to no harm.
